What’s the VWAP Indicator?

The VWAP indicator (Quantity Weighted Common Value) is a well-liked buying and selling software used to measure the typical value of an asset, factoring in each value and quantity over a particular timeframe, normally intraday. It differs from common transferring averages as a result of it emphasizes the amount at every value stage, providing a extra nuanced view of the value motion.

How is VWAP Calculated?

To calculate VWAP, you are taking the entire greenback quantity of trades (value occasions quantity) and divide it by the entire quantity. Primarily, it provides you the typical value paid per share, adjusted for what number of shares have been traded at every value level.

VWAP = (Value x Quantity) / Whole Quantity

How the VWAP Indicator Works in Buying and selling

The VWAP indicator in buying and selling integrates two important components: value and quantity. By weighing the worth by quantity, it gives a extra detailed image of market sentiment. This is a key precept to recollect:

  • When the worth is above VWAP, it’s thought-about bullish, indicating that the market is trending upwards and merchants are keen to pay above the typical value.

  • When the worth is under VWAP, it is considered as bearish, exhibiting that the asset is buying and selling under its common value, and the market could also be in a downward development.

At first of a brand new day (midnight) the VWAP resets. Early within the day, you see that the worth is buying and selling round VWAP. An early day breakaway from the VWAP is widespread and it is very important analyze if the breakaway succeeds or fails. Within the instance under, the preliminary breakaway decrease fails which places the percentages within the favor of a bull market. 

Going ahead, VWAP pullbacks and retests can then be used to establish entry indicators.

VWAP vs. Transferring Averages: Key Variations

Whereas each VWAP and transferring averages (like SMA and EMA) are used to research value tendencies, they’ve vital variations.

Easy Transferring Averages (SMA) and Exponential Transferring Averages (EMA) are calculated purely based mostly on value and are generally used to easy value knowledge over a set interval. Nevertheless, they don’t account for quantity, which could be a key driver of value motion.

 

VWAP vs. Transferring Common: When to Use Every

The VWAP indicator is particularly beneficial for intraday merchants because it resets every day and incorporates quantity, making it a extra correct reflection of market sentiment inside that day. Alternatively, transferring averages are extra helpful for figuring out longer-term tendencies.

  • Use VWAP for short-term, intraday methods to search out the typical value adjusted for quantity.

  • Use transferring averages for development evaluation over longer intervals, the place quantity knowledge is much less important.

Within the situation under, the every day 30 EMA (black line) supplies the long-term development route. And since the worth is buying and selling above the every day 30 EMA, merchants solely search for lengthy indicators and ignore all quick indicators.

The VWAP can then be used to search out lengthy intraday indicators into the long-term development route. All bearish VWAP indicators under the VWAP are ignored.

Why Do Skilled Merchants Use VWAP?

Skilled merchants continuously depend on VWAP to evaluate whether or not they’re executing trades at a good value in comparison with the remainder of the market. It serves as a value benchmark that ensures massive trades don’t considerably affect market costs.

Retail merchants can use VWAP equally to observe market exercise and achieve a way of whether or not they’re shopping for or promoting at a good value relative to institutional exercise.

 

Widespread VWAP Buying and selling Methods

There are a number of standard VWAP buying and selling methods that merchants can implement to benefit from value tendencies.

 

Breakout Buying and selling

A breakout technique utilizing VWAP includes ready for the worth to maneuver considerably above or under the VWAP line. As an illustration, if the worth crosses above VWAP with rising quantity, it might sign a bullish breakout.

Within the situation under, the worth traded inside a slim triangle sample simply above the VWAP. The sturdy breakout candle then supplied a possible entry sign as value was breaking away strongly from the VWAP.

Pullback Technique

In a pullback technique, merchants search for value retracements again to the VWAP line after a robust transfer. For instance, after the worth rallies above VWAP, a pullback to the VWAP stage might current a shopping for alternative, assuming the upward development continues.

The value is in an preliminary uptrend buying and selling above the VWAP. The pullback into the VWAP was profitable as a result of the VWAP held as assist stage and the worth was by no means capable of shut under the VWAP. The sturdy bullish candle away from the VWAP might have been a possible entry sign into the uptrend.

FAQs on VWAP in Buying and selling

What timeframe is greatest for utilizing VWAP?

VWAP is only on intraday charts, because it resets every day and is designed for short-term buying and selling.

If you’re on the lookout for longer-term method, you may change the anchor interval to weekly which makes the VWAP in the beginning of a brand new week.

 

Can VWAP be used for long-term buying and selling?

Whereas VWAP is primarily a day-trading software, it might supply worth in longer-term buying and selling when used alongside different indicators. Nevertheless, its effectiveness diminishes the longer the timeframe.

 

How does VWAP carry out in low-volume markets?

In low-volume markets, VWAP might be much less dependable as a result of lack of adequate knowledge, resulting in distorted indicators.

 

How do institutional merchants use VWAP to their benefit?

Institutional merchants use VWAP to execute massive trades with out considerably impacting market costs, making certain they’re getting a mean value similar to different merchants.
